Learn to design and develop modern GUI applications for embedded and desktop systems using Qt C++ and QML for high-performance, interactive interfaces.
This course is designed for embedded engineers, application developers, and UI designers. Gain practical skills in Qt C++ programming, QML interface design, signal-slot mechanism, animations, and hardware integration for embedded systems.
Install Qt environment and create your first Qt Widgets and QML application.
Implement signal-slot communication and property binding in QML and C++.
Create reusable QML components and design responsive layouts.
Add animations, transitions, and state management in QML interfaces.
Integrate QML GUI with hardware or simulated embedded backend.